According to foreign media reports, the Hosein Research Group of Syracuse University has developed a new solid electrolyte to replace the liquid electrolyte in the current aluminum-ion battery, enabling it to meet high-demand applications such as automobiles.
The demand for batteries for electric vehicles such as private, public and commercial transportation (cars, buses, trucks) is increasing, so people have begun to develop LR41 battery to meet the demand. Electric vehicles require a lot of electricity to operate normally, which places high demands on batteries, resulting in batteries that must be able to undergo fast and violent electrochemical reactions to drive external power (such as motors, electronic devices, etc.). However, such reactions in turn cause great mechanical pressure and thermal stress on the battery. Current battery technology uses liquids as electrolytes, which help transfer ions from one electrode to another, but such electrolytes are composed of organic molecules and are extremely flammable and volatile. As a result, electric vehicle batteries have a higher safety risk of explosion, fire, exhaust or failure.
According to foreign media reports, the Hosein Research Group at Syracuse University has developed a new solid electrolyte to replace the liquid electrolyte in current LR41 battery, enabling them to meet high-demand applications such as automobiles. The electrolyte consists of a very soft polymer and a very hard epoxy resin. The polymer also allows aluminum ions to penetrate, while the epoxy resin provides thermal stability and durability. The polymer is converted into an aluminum-ion electrolyte by dissolving aluminum salts (such as aluminum nitrate) into the polymer matrix.
